Brahmanadei Population - Nayagarh, Orissa

Brahmanadei is a very small village located in Nuagaon Block of Nayagarh district, Orissa with total 6 families residing. The Brahmanadei village has population of 25 of which 16 are males while 9 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Brahmanadei village population of children with age 0-6 is 2 which makes up 8.00 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Brahmanadei village is 563 which is lower than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Brahmanadei as per census is 1000, higher than Orissa average of 941.

Brahmanadei village has higher liter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Brahmanadei village was 91.30 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Brahmanadei Male literacy stands at 93.33 % while female literacy rate was 87.50 %.
